Output 2b51d8e50793b1c4317860d1101c3d2530842aaac53bd9ee1334e39d7826f827:2

value
289409
script pubkey
OP_0 OP_PUSHBYTES_20 501344549a059620935e2a233bc57b275a2a5e7f
address
bc1q2qf5g4y6qktzpy679g3nh3tmyadz5hnl7mrjcq
transaction
2b51d8e50793b1c4317860d1101c3d2530842aaac53bd9ee1334e39d7826f827
confirmations
31489
spent
true